Primary responsibilities for this position include, but are not limited to:
* Develop and implement supplier quality evaluation and control systems aligned with contract requirements and NG policies.
* Assess and assure supplier processes and product quality, ensuring compliance with contractual, regulatory, and technical standards.
* Lead supplier risk management, including classification (Critical, Key, Standard), pre-award capability assessments, and source-selection evaluations.
* Conduct supplier audits, performance assessments, and product/process verification activities; monitor performance trends and report risks to management.
* Manage supplier non-conformances, waivers, deviations, and discrepancy reporting (Material Review Board); drive root-cause analysis and corrective-preventive actions.
* Oversee source inspection and coordination with customers; verify completeness of End Item Data Packages and manufacturing travelers prior to shipment.
* Maintain the approved supplier list and SAP Vendor/Part Master databases; utilize performance data and assessment tools to evaluate supplier capability.
* Interface with program management, engineering, procurement, and supplier management to align procurements with mission-assurance objectives.
* Communicate supplier performance, quality status, and risk updates to senior management and stakeholders.
